A Regency Mahogany Folio Stand], having two slatted adjustable folio rests on a strongly-made base with plain standard ends and trestle bases with bun feet and castors, 67cm wide *This stand closely resembles one illustrated in "Gillows' Estimate Sketch Book" (344/100, p.3037), dated 29 Feb 1820. Two similar stands, one stamped GILLOWS LANCASTER, are at Temple Newsam House, Leeds (see Gilbert 1978 II, No.307)

Ernest Howard Shepard (1879-1976) Us Too Pencil, pen and ink on card Signed and dated Jan 28. 36.5cm x 24cm Provenance: The mother of the vendor worked for a Mrs Purvis of Home Close, Burghfield Common in the 1920s/30s. Mrs Purvis was a friend of Shepard, and gave the picture to the mother of the vendor after her service came to an end. It was not uncommon for Shepard to complete replica gifts of illustrations, which is what we understand this sketch to be. The original can be seen on p. 35 in Now We Are Six, first published 1927.
